Ohio LLC, living in CA
Hi all, new here and I see this has been discussed before but it's been a few years. I've recently formed an Ohio 2 member LLC (my husband and I) for a SFR I'm closing on next month. I live in CA. I understand I'll need to file in CA with the FTB as a foreign LLC and pay the $800 whether or not the LLC makes money. It appears in Ohio the LLC must have gross receipts of $150,000 to file the CAT and pay $150 (so thinking I need to do nothing in Ohio since annual rents will be well under).
So my question is do I need to file a state return in each state on behalf of the LLC? It is 2 member (my husband and I, therefore it's a pass through entity). Then my next question is do I need to file a personal return in Ohio since the income is taxed on a pass through basis? Or am I way over thinking this?

On a related but separate note, don't forget that many cities in Ohio also have a tax which requires a LLC to file a return.
